ARGENTINIAN UFC star Santiago Ponzinibbio offered to fight Canelo Alvarez as he jumped to the defence of compatriot Lionel Messi.

Argentina beat Mexico 2-0 in their World Cup Group C match with seven-time Ballon d’Or winner Messi getting a goal and an assist.

Wild scenes in the Argentine dressing room followed as they kept their qualification hopes alive after losing their first group match 2-1 to Saudi Arabia.

A clip was shared of the joyous scenes, but it showed a Mexico shirt on the floor near Messi, and as the Paris Saint-Germain man took his boot off, his foot brushed the jersey – which boxer Canelo found disrespectful.

And that led to the Mexican boxing legend saying Messi “better pray to God that I don’t find him”.

Canelo tweeted: “Did you guys see Messi cleaning the floor with our jersey and flag. He better pray to God that I don’t find him.

“Just like I respect Argentina, he has to respect Mexico! I’m not talking about the country as a whole, just about the bulls**t that Messi did.”

However, welterweight Ponzinibbio, who has won 28 of his 34 MMA fights, has now joined the likes of Sergio Aguero by wading into the row and having Messi’s back.

The grappler, who faces Robbie Lawler at UFC 282 on December 10, told MMA Fighting: “No point threatening Messi. Everybody knows Messi’s career. If [Canelo] doesn’t know he shouldn’t say a thing.

“It’s normal for players to throw jerseys on the ground, they are all sweaty, but he didn’t do anything disrespectful.

“Everybody that knows Messi knows he’s an impeccable athlete and a very respectful person.”

Ponzinibbio added: “[Messi] had an excellent match. I was upset. Brother, if you want to fight, I’m ready, but leave Messi be,

“You mess with Messi, you mess with the entire Argentina. Don’t bother the kid.”

Argentina face off with Poland in the third group game of the World Cup, with the two sides occupying the top two slots in Group C.

A draw will send Argentina through to the knockouts if Saudi Arabia and Mexico also draw, or if the Mexicans win by up to a two-goal margin.
